Yahoo Japan and Line set to merge
Image copyright Tomohiro Ohsumi
Japan’s biggest search engine and messaging app are set to merge under a deal agreed by their parent companies.
Yahoo Japan is the country’s biggest search engine, and has e-commerce and online banking subsidiaries.
Line is the country’s dominant messaging app, and is also popular in Southeast Asia and Taiwan.
